A short, rapid mimimimi vocal sound with a playful, nagging rhythm, circulated online and used in memes, teasing edits, and comic reaction videos.

This brief vocal clip consists of a quick string of repeated “mi” syllables delivered in a rhythmic, exaggerated way. Its tightly packed repetition can resemble playful whining, mock complaining, or someone imitating chatter without using actual words. The sound creates an instantly silly, mildly irritating effect that works especially well when a person is rambling, refusing to listen, or making a dramatic fuss. Because the clip lasts only a few seconds, it can punctuate a visual joke without interrupting the pace of a short edit.

The original speaker, recording date, and source work for this specific clip are not confirmed. Online, repeated mimimi vocalizations are commonly treated as comic shorthand for whining, nagging, or speech that another person does not want to hear. This compact recording fits reaction videos and short-form meme edits because its meaning is conveyed through rhythm and tone rather than a complete phrase. It remains useful as a reusable interruption gag, especially when creators want to dismiss a rant without quoting or answering it directly.
